No single definition of intelligence because different theorists have very different assumptions about. Some researchers view intelligence as a single trait that influences all aspects of cognitive functioning. Hypothesis that each of us possess a certain amount of g (general intelligence) and that it influences our ability to think and learn on all intellectual tasks. Intelligence: trait or series of traits, characterizing some people to a greater extent than others. Goal is to identify these traits and how to measure them so that we can understand differences in terms of the level of intelligence. To identify those traits, to measure them, to assess individual differences. Lumpers individuals who believe we have one general capacity and one overall intelligence score (iq), general capacity, one overall score (ex; binet) Splitters idea that there are separate abilities that function independently (wexler scales, Gardener 7), better to talk about peoples abilities in various areas (ex; wechsler, gardner)
